Transaction 802fcb43e5d624442fcc0438c5deb416f2d159d855d6d015c54e1c1addacccf4

22 Input
1 Outputs
  • 802fcb43e5d624442fcc0438c5deb416f2d159d855d6d015c54e1c1addacccf4:0
  • value  472498374
    address  33DwLaEBsmrECgBYqufiBbfxpGUAKUJkph